Abstract

The utility model discloses a dry sowing fertilizer distributor for a rice field. The dry sowing fertilizer mainly comprises a front spar, a rear spar, a land wheel, a bracket, a bevel gear gearbox, a fertilizer placer, a seeding opener, a fertilizer box, a seed box and chain wheels. When the dry sowing fertilizer distributor works, before a tractor is started, a power output shaft firstly drives the chain wheels at two sides of the bevel gear gearbox through a universal joint drive shaft to drive a fertilizer apparatus and a seeding apparatus below the fertilizer box and the seed box to rotate to discharge fertilize and seed, and then the dry sowing fertilizer distributor runs by virtue of a clutch of the tractor, and therefore fertilizing and seeding are not paused even if the tractor stops and is restarted in the middle of operation. In addition, the fertilizer placer and the seeding opener in the scheme adopt profile modeled structures, and a depth limiting wheel is arranged at the side of the seeding opener, so that the dry sowing fertilizer distributor can meet the requirements of different land conditions, and is good in operation quality and simple in structure.

Technical background
Rice on honda dry farming is a new cropping pattern, and its work flow is on the soil of having ploughed, soil block to be pulverized, and then carries out seeding and fertilizing, suppression, spraying herbicide, the irrigation until young rice seedlings growth to four leaf waters wholeheartedly time; The energy, saving of labor's environmental protection are not only economized on water, saved to this kind of work pattern, and output is not less than rice transplanting, well received, all transforms enforcement by manual operation or to existing facility though effect is good; Reason is that rice on honda dry farming is strict to the requirement of seed seed level, existing facility first can not be controlled seed level, when the second sowing, provide power by facility land wheel, when between the starting of the locomotive edge of a field or operation, stop, land wheel can not immediately provide power drive seeding, fertilizer apparatus work cause a segment distance vacancy without kind, fertilizer, produce Uneven seedlings affect output; For agriculture sustainable development, ensure grain security, as early as possible rice on honda dry farming work pattern is promoted, benefit rice agriculture, the seeding and fertilizer spreading machine that development can be supporting with rice on honda dry farming agronomy as early as possible will become the task of top priority.
